Trend Analysis: Preventing Revenge Quitting

In a recent survey conducted by a leading HR consultancy, it was revealed that one in four employees have considered leaving their jobs specifically to make a point about dissatisfaction with their employer. This phenomenon, dubbed “revenge quitting,” is a clear indicator of the growing disconnect between employees and their workplaces.

Strategies for Prevention

Listening to Employee Expectations

Acknowledging and understanding modern employee expectations can greatly mitigate revenge quitting. Nowadays, employees seek more than conventional benefits; they prioritize work-life balance, career advancement opportunities, and mental well-being. Businesses that adopt policies reflecting these desires are more likely to retain top talent. Implementing open feedback channels and flexible work options can align organizations with evolving employee needs, reducing dramatic exits.

The Role of Leadership in Retention

Effective leadership is pivotal in preventing employee discontent and subsequent revenge quitting. Leaders who are empathetic and supportive tend to foster a healthier work environment. Organizations are increasingly investing in leadership development programs to ensure their managers are equipped to inspire and retain their teams. Transformative leaders establish trust and loyalty, which are essential in minimizing employees’ desire to quit out of spite.

Cultivating Psychological Safety

The concept of psychological safety plays a crucial role in employee retention. When employees feel secure to express their ideas and concerns without fear of negative consequences, it leads to a more engaged and committed workforce. Establishing a culture of open communication and respect ensures that employees feel valued, reducing the likelihood of them leaving in a demonstrative manner.
